Shaky hands
I'm having problem of shaky hands for above 1 yr as started noticing it. How can I overcome this problem? What could be possible reasons for it?

Hello.....Tremor is generally caused by problems in parts of the brain that control muscles throughout the body or in particular areas, such as the hands.   Tremors could  be due to anxiety,  hyperthyroidism,  alcohol withdrawal,  liver cirrhosis are some of the causes.  Underlying condition should  be treated. Consul  general physician.
